Implement Advanced Schema & Structured Data
In 2026, Schema markup is the primary language of search. By providing search engines with explicit, structured data, you remove the guesswork for AI crawlers trying to interpret your content. Advanced implementation ensures your brand’s key details—like pricing, reviews, and professional credentials—are accurately pulled into interactive search rich snippets and AI-generated comparison tables.
Author Schema
Establishing E-E-A-T starts with the “Person” schema. By 2026, Google prioritizes content verified by real experts. By linking an author’s professional history, social profiles, and past publications directly within your code, you prove to AI engines that your information comes from a credible, human source. This transparency is a critical ranking factor for health, finance, and technical niches.
Product & FAQ Schema
Maximize your real estate on the SERP (Search Engine Results Page) using Product and FAQ Schema. These tags allow AI agents to pull real-time data, such as stock availability or direct answers to common customer hurdles, directly into the search interface. This high-level technical optimization reduces friction for the user and positions your brand as the most accessible solution in your industry.

Regular Content Audits
Static content is dead weight. To maintain high rankings, implement a rolling audit cycle where cornerstone articles are updated every six months. Replace outdated statistics, refresh “current year” mentions, and verify that all outbound links still point to authoritative sources. This constant refinement signals to AI engines that your brand is a live, active expert in your field.
AI Crawler Access
Technical SEO in 2026 requires managing “Bot Rights.” Review your robots.txt file to ensure you aren’t inadvertently blocking critical agents like GPTBot, CCBot, or Google-InspectionTool. If AI models cannot access your site’s high-quality data, they cannot cite you in their answers. Strategic accessibility ensures your brand remains the primary knowledge source for generative search engines.
